This brutal, scary horror thriller stars Franka Potente as Kate, a party-girl who wakes up late at night on the platform of a locked, deserted Tube station. When an empty train pulls in, she gets on, little realising she's embarking on a nightmare journey of blood and death, as a killer who haunts the Underground seeks out fresh victims...

Christopher Smith's Creep is firmly in the mould of Hostel and Saw, but in a very British setting (he went on to write and direct Severance). Inspired by Gary Sherman's 1972 classic Death Line, the film suggests that parallel to the Tube tunnels are others - some harmless sewers, others more dangerous - that might, for example, have been dug by survivors of genetic experiments at a hospital above the Underground line.

The film makes the most of the claustrophobic setting and Smith manages to conjure up other victims for the killer to set the scene and increase the horrors before Kate must face him, or, more precisely, it...
